Mikel Arteta was naturally disappointed with his side’s elimination from the competition after Arsenal were beaten 3-1 on aggregate by PSG. There were chances that the side did not take and despite their spirited start, the Parisians were simply much more clinical.
It means that now Arsenal’s season will end without silverware once again and they face a fight in their final three matches to hold onto second place in the league. For Arteta, some of his answers leave us arguably with more questions as he was determined to point out who he felt were the best team.
Here is every word from Mikel Arteta’s press conference:
